Cart

Earth Animal Spot Flea & Tick Medium

$11.65

Out of stock

SKU: 853965006965 Category:
Description

Earth Animal Spot Flea & Tick Medium

Reviews (0)

Reviews

There are no reviews yet.

Be the first to review “Earth Animal Spot Flea & Tick Medium”